Best Gambrills 糖心原创s (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 6 private schools serving 875 students in Gambrills, MD (there are , serving 5,533 public students). 14% of all K-12 students in Gambrills, MD are educated in private schools (compared to the MD state average of 14%).
The top-ranked private school in Gambrills, MD is School Of The Incarnation.
The average acceptance rate is 93%, which is higher than the Maryland private school average acceptance rate of 81%.
17% of private schools in Gambrills, MD are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
